"use strict";
Object.defineProperty(exports, "__esModule", { value: true });
const validation_1 = require("../validation");
const common_1 = require("../validators/common");
class CommonValidatorBuilderImpl {
constructor(validationRule) {
this.validationRule = validationRule;
}
/*
* ==================
* Validation options
* ==================
*/
withFailureCode(errorCode) {
this.validationRule.setErrorCode(errorCode);
return this;
}
withFailureMessage(errorMessage) {
this.validationRule.setErrorMessage(errorMessage);
return this;
}
withSeverity(severity) {
this.validationRule.setSeverity(severity);
return this;
}
withPropertyName(name) {
this.validationRule.setPropertyName(name);
return this;
}
whenDefined() {
this.validationRule.addCondition(new validation_1.WhenDefinedCondition(this.validationRule.lambdaExpression));
return this;
}
whenNotNull() {
this.validationRule.addCondition(new validation_1.WhenNotNullCondition(this.validationRule.lambdaExpression));
return this;
}
when(expression) {
this.validationRule.addCondition(new validation_1.WhenCondition(expression));
return this;
}
unless(expression) {
this.validationRule.addCondition(new validation_1.UnlessCondition(expression));
return this;
}
onFailure(callback) {
this.validationRule.onFailure(callback);
return this;
}
fulfills(validatable) {
if (typeof validatable === "object") {
this.validationRule.addValidator({
isValid: function (input) {
return validatable.validate(input).isValid();
}
});
}
else {
this.validationRule.addValidator({
isValid: function (input) {
return validatable(input);
}
});
}
return this;
}
/*
* =======================
* Common validation rules
* =======================
*/
isDefined() {
this.validationRule.addValidator(new common_1.IsDefinedValidator());
return this;
}
isUndefined() {
this.validationRule.addValidator(new common_1.IsUndefinedValidator());
return this;
}
isNull() {
this.validationRule.addValidator(new common_1.IsNullValidator());
return this;
}
isNotNull() {
this.validationRule.addValidator(new common_1.IsNotNullValidator());
return this;
}
isEmpty() {
this.validationRule.addValidator(new common_1.IsEmptyValidator());
return this;
}
isNotEmpty() {
this.validationRule.addValidator(new common_1.IsNotEmptyValidator());
return this;
}
isEqualTo(comparison) {
this.validationRule.addValidator(new common_1.IsEqualValidator(comparison));
return this;
}
isNotEqualTo(comparison) {
this.validationRule.addValidator(new common_1.IsNotEqualValidator(comparison));
return this;
}
isIn(iterable) {
this.validationRule.addValidator(new common_1.IsInValidator(iterable));
return this;
}
isNotIn(iterable) {
this.validationRule.addValidator(new common_1.IsNotInValidator(iterable));
return this;
}
}
exports.CommonValidatorBuilderImpl = CommonValidatorBuilderImpl;
